public override bool Equals(object obj) { Leitura leitura = obj as Leitura; if (leitura == null) { return(false); } return(base.Equals(obj)); }
public override bool Equals(Object l) { Leitura leitura = l as Leitura; if (leitura == null) { return(false); } return(Casa.Equals(leitura.Casa)); }
private void RegistrarConsumo(String casa, double consumo) { Leitura leitura = new Leitura(casa, consumo); if (leituras.Contains(leitura)) { MessageBox.Show("A leitura para esta casa ja foi registrada", "Alerta!", MessageBoxButtons.OK, MessageBoxIcon.Warning); } else { this.leituras.Add(leitura); InicializaFormulario(); } }
private void button1_Click(object sender, EventArgs e) { Leitura leitura = new Leitura(txtCasa.Text, Convert.ToDouble(txtConsumo.Text)); if (leituras.Contains(leitura)) { MessageBox.Show("A leitura para esta casa já foi registrada", "Alerta", MessageBoxButtons.OK, MessageBoxIcon.Warning); } else { this.leituras.Add(leitura); dgvLeituras.DataSource = this.leituras; } }
private void RegistraConsumo(string casa, double consumo) { Leitura leitura = new Leitura(casa, consumo); if (leituras.Contains(leitura)) { MessageBox.Show( "A leitura para esta casa já foi registrada", "Alerta", MessageBoxButtons.OK, MessageBoxIcon.Warning ); } else { this.leituras.Add(leitura); InicializaFormulario(); } }